Is this propeller for a single or dual prop setup?
This is a component for a Duoprop system, meaning it is designed to work in conjunction with another propeller (rear prop) on the same sterndrive for enhanced performance and efficiency.
What is the primary benefit of a Duoprop system over a single prop?
Duoprop systems, with their counter-rotating propellers, significantly improve acceleration, top-end speed, and fuel efficiency by reducing rotational slip and increasing thrust compared to single propeller setups.
